在Linux系统中,查看当前目录的大小可以通过多种命令实现,以下是一些常用的方法:
du
命令du
(Disk Usage)命令用于估算文件和目录的磁盘使用情况。
du -sh .
-s
参数表示总结(summarize),只显示总计。-h
参数表示以人类可读的格式(如K、M、G)显示大小。.
表示当前目录。示例输出:
1.5G .
df
命令df
(Disk Free)命令用于显示Linux文件系统的磁盘空间使用情况。
df -h .
-h
参数同样用于人类可读的格式。.
指定查看当前目录所在文件系统的磁盘空间。示例输出:
Filesystem Size Used Avail Use% Mounted on
/dev/sda1 20G 15G 4.3G 78% /
原因: 目录下文件数量过多或存在大量小文件,导致命令执行缓慢。
解决方法:
du
命令时,可以尝试限制递归深度:du
命令时,可以尝试限制递归深度:ncdu
工具(需先安装):ncdu
工具(需先安装):ncdu
提供了一个交互式的界面,可以更直观地查看和管理目录大小。通过以上方法,你可以有效地查看和管理Linux系统中当前目录的大小。
领取专属 10元无门槛券
手把手带您无忧上云